Adwumayɛ Nnyinasosɛm: Capacitor Ahoɔden a Wɔkora So ne Ntɛm ara a Wɔde Gu
Nnyinasosɛm titiriw a ɛwɔ capacitor discharge projection welding mfiri mu no fa capacitors a wɔde bedi dwuma de asie anyinam ahoɔden ahoɔden na wɔawie welding denam instantaneous discharge so bere a ɛho hia. Adeyɛ pɔtee no te sɛ nea edidi so yi:

  • Ahoɔden a Wɔkora So Fa: Adwinnade no dannan AC ahoɔden kɔ DC ahoɔden mu denam rectifier so, na ɛkora anyinam ahoɔden so yiye denam capacitor bank ahorow a ɛbɔ so.
  • Discharge Phase: Sɛ wɔhyɛ welding ase a, capacitors no gyae ahoɔden denam resistance welding transformer so, na ɛyɛ high-current pulses (ɛkɔ amperes mpempem pii) de wie welding wɔ bere tiaa bi mu (mpɛn pii no ennu milisecond 20).
  • Ahoɔden a Ɛwɔ Ahoɔden: Ɔhyew ne nhyɛso a ɛkɔ soro a efi nsu a wɔde gu mu no de ba no yɛ adwuma tẽẽ wɔ weld point no so, na ɛma dade nneɛma no nwene wɔ mpɔtam hɔ na ɛyɛ den ntɛmntɛm ma ɛyɛ nkitahodi a emu yɛ den.

Saa adeyɛ yi kwati adesoa a ɛkɔ soro a wɔhwehwɛ wɔ anyinam ahoɔden grid no so a atetesɛm welding mfiri hwehwɛ bere a wonya welding a ɛkorɔn- denam discharge parameters a wɔhwɛ so pɛpɛɛpɛ no so.

Su Titiriw: Adwumayɛ a Etu mpɔn, Gyinabea, ne Nsakrae

1.Nneɛma a Wɔde Di Dwuma a Ɛkorɔn ne Ahoɔden a Wɔkora So
Ahoɔden a wɔkora so-discharge mode a capacitor discharge projection welding mfiri ahorow no tew ahoɔden a wɔsɛe no so kɛse na enni nkɛntɛnso ketewaa bi wɔ power grid no so. Ne su a ɛma nsu fi mu ntɛm ara no ma wotumi wie welding no ntɛmntɛm, na ɛma nneɛma a wɔyɛ no tu mpɔn kɛse.

2.Welding a Ɛkorɔn
Esiane bere tiaa a wɔde fi mu (bɛyɛ sekan nkyem mpem abiɛsa-), beae a ɔhyew-ka no sua koraa, na ɛtew adwumayɛbea a ɛsakra, kɔla a ɛsakra, ne nsɛm afoforo so yiye, na ɛma ɛfata titiriw ma dade afã horow a wɔde yɛ adwuma pɛpɛɛpɛ (te sɛ dade a ɛnyɛ den, kɔbere a wɔde afra, ne nea ɛkeka ho).

3.Nsakrae a Ɛyɛ Den
Adwinnade no betumi adi nneɛma ahorow a ɛyɛ den ne welding ahwehwɛde ahorow ho dwuma wɔ ɔkwan a ɛyɛ mmerɛw so denam nsakrae a wɔbɛyɛ wɔ parameters te sɛ charging voltage ne discharge bere so. Sɛ nhwɛsoɔ no, tumi a ɛkorɔn-tumi nhwɛsoɔ (te sɛ 20,000J level) tumi yɛ nneɛma a ɛyɛ den te sɛ dadeɛ a ahoɔden kɛseɛ-wɔ ne dadeɛ a ɛyɛ hyeɛ-ayɛ ho adwuma.

4.Nyansa so Nkonimdi
Nnɛyi capacitor discharge projection welding mfiri ahorow no wɔ microcomputer nhyehyɛe ahorow a ɛboa real-bere monitoring ne parameter nsakrae, hwɛ hu sɛ ahoɔden a ɛyɛ den ma weld biara na ɛma product consistency tu mpɔn.
